The Torrance Cherry Blossom Cultural Festival – FA > On Sunday, Columbia Park in Torrance is the perfect place to enjoy cherry blossom season. Torrance’s free annual event will include live performances, a variety of crafts by local artisans, food trucks, and local cuisine all centered around the blooming cherry blossom. Runs 11 a.m. to 4 p.m. More info here.
Coffee & Clay Sunday FUNday – FA > Experience a unique fusion of specialty caffeine and ceramic arts at Claytivity Burbank. Co-hosted by Zomu Coffee, this “Sunday FUNday” features a curated menu of specialty coffee, matcha, and hojicha, alongside a showcase of featured ceramic artists. The atmosphere is set by a live, recorded DJ set from Zen Zaddy (playing until 2 p.m.), providing the perfect soundtrack for a hands-on wheel throwing demonstration. The event runs from 10 a.m. to 3 p.m. More info here.
Delirium Musicum at BroadStage -> Bring a little rhythm to your Sunday morning with the “ferocious and rhythmically mesmerizing” sounds of Delirium Musicum, the self-conducted, Los Angeles-based chamber orchestra returning to the BroadStage. Known for their electrifying 21st-century interpretations, the ensemble bridges the gap between Baroque masterpieces and contemporary compositions. This 60-minute, no-intermission performance offers an “out-of-the-box” approach to classical music, showcasing the next wave of world-class musicians in an intimate setting. Performance beings at 11 a.m. Tickets are $55. More info here.
Seven More Things To Do in L.A. Today
- This Saturday and Sunday, North Hollywood’s beloved open-air Vegan Street Fair returns for a two-day celebration of all things plant-based. Dozens of local vegan restaurants and vendors descend on one block to serve up bite-sized portions for $5 or less.
- This Saturday and Sunday, the City of Malibu celebrates the 25th Annual Chumash Day Powwow and Intertribal Gathering at Malibu Bluffs Park. FA
- This Thursday to Sunday, the 33rd annual Los Angeles Women’s Theatre Festival returns with the theme “The Strength We Carry.” Celebrating 33 years, this multicultural event showcases extraordinary solo performers from around the globe through six distinct programs.
- Manila Sound returns to Benny Boy Brewing on Sunday with a backyard dance party featuring an all-women lineup of DJs. FA
- Namastray comes to Common Space Brewery on Sunday to host an afternoon edition of Puppy Yoga.
- On Sunday, Angel City Brewery will host Yokai Mall, a collector-focused anime and Japanese pop culture vendor market.
- The Culver City Book Festival comes to the Wende Museum on Sunday from 10 a.m. to 5 p.m.
